Luxurious Spa and Fine Dining: Experience ultimate relaxation at our spa offering massages and facials, then indulge in exquisite cuisine at Maggie Oakes.
Top-Notch Amenities: Enjoy complimentary Wi-Fi, concierge services, and room service, with a business center and limo service available for your convenience.
Prime Location: Centrally located near popular attractions such as Jacques Cartier Square and Bonsecours Market, Hotel William Gray is the perfect choice for your Montreal getaway. Don't miss out on this opportunity to stay at our luxury aparthotel.

Unprofessional! + New Year’s Eve Ball at Hotel William Gray was my first experience and definitely my last. Because of the announced Old Port road closures, I contacted the hotel days in advance to ask how guests attending the event (without a room reservation) should plan their arrival, parking, and timing. I live only 20 minutes away, so a room was not essential, but proper planning was. I was initially told there would be no issue arriving at 7 PM. After I forwarded official city notices recommending arrival before 5 PM, the hotel replied that valet parking was an option on a first come, first served basis, or nearby street parking. Based on this information, I arrived early at 4:45 PM, expecting to park at valet. At arrival, the valet attendant informed me that valet parking was only for hotel guests with rooms, despite this never being mentioned in any email. A Charm in Old Montreal + What a great stay in Old Montreal! A fantastic location to walk around both day and night. Staff was wonderful. Our room was clean and we liked the decor. If you like walking and the weather is ok, you can certainly walk to Ste Catherine Street - -about 20 minutes. We walked to The Bell Centre to watch the Habs and it was 28 minutes. Try the roof top bar for a drink and to see the city at night. It’s heated so you won’t be cold. We would love to come back!

Cool Vibes Old Port Montreal + It is said that Montreal Quebec has two seasons, winter and construction. And indeed we experienced this on our recent stay in Montreal. Will Gray is well situated in Old Port Montreal. You can see, smell and walk history right here. The location perfect, steps from Ferris wheel, clock tower, urban beach, science center, shops and restaurants… A few steps to the Basilica, under construction but still open for tours, light show and concerts. Will Gray also under construction of lobby and meeting area although the staff well communicated short bursts of drilling and noise. Halls quiet, rooms soothing, front desk/concierge/ doormen helpful. Meals at connected Maggie Oaks delicious and well staffed. This is where you want to be when visiting Montreal; enjoy the serenity of this most comfortable hotel and imagine today amidst the past.

Back for our 2nd stay — Ready for our 3rd! + This is our second time staying at Hotel William Gray in Montreal — and we’ll stay here again on our next visit! Perfect location on a charming street, walkable to restaurants and Metro (you can get anywhere you need to go in Montreal by subway or bus so easily, including the airport). Great coffee shop in the same building. Relaxed, stylish atmosphere (i.e. cool, but not a scene). Delicious smelling Le Labo bath amenities in the rooms. Very helpful and warm staff. Twice daily housekeeping visits if you’d like (and the green/red light system is genius; no clumsy door hangers). Did I miss anything? We love it here.
